**Residential Childcare Worker**

We are a long-established family owned business with an excellent reputation for providing high quality care placements for young people aged between 5-18 years with complex needs and challenging behaviour.

We are looking to recruit enthusiastic, highly motivated individuals to join our team.

**Key duties and responsibilities**

Do you have what it takes to become an exceptional part of a residential childcare company and make a difference to the lives of the children and young people?

Brookfield Care offers a comprehensive training package that will enable you to develop skills to work therapeutically with our young people, including attachment theories and working with traumatised young people. You will be required to develop close working relationships with the therapists, working systemically to ensure you will be contributing to the delivery of a comprehensive 'therapeutic service' within Brookfield Care.

We are currently looking to recruit dedicated Residential Support Workers to assist us in the promotion of good childcare practice in accordance with our extremely high company standards.

We are an Equal Opportunities employer and applicants must be eligible to work in the UK. Flexibility is essential, as applicants must be able to work on a rota basis which will include weekends, sleepovers and bank holidays. Rotas are completed 3-4 weeks in advance, giving rest days in between shifts, having the advantage of being able to plan a healthy work life balance.
